Description

维萨里3D解剖是300+所高校选择的人体解剖学习平台!基于真实人体数据构建,结构精准、细节逼真,权威专家严格审核。遵循人卫版系统解剖学、局部解剖学等权威教材,打造符合教学体系的专业3D解剖软件,为多款解剖数字教材提供人体资源。无论你是医学生、医生、教师、健身瑜伽普拉提教练、正骨推拿、康复理疗师,还是对大健康感兴趣的学习者,或是从事美术和体育运动行业,这里都有适合你的学习资源。 【特色内容】 ●骨骼:骨骼的解剖结构、骨性标志、形态分部采用色块标注,区域清晰明了,比教材和解剖图谱完整详尽。 ●肌肉起止点:肌肉起止点标注分明,随时查看各肌肉的血供、神经支配、肌肉触诊视频和肌肉动作动画等丰富资源。 ●解剖重难点:独家十二对脑神经、血液循环演示3D模型和重难点原理讲解视频。 ●3D解剖图谱:可自由转变视角的解剖图谱,肌肉血管腔隙重点标注,支持自主创建解剖图谱学习笔记。 ●系统解剖:男女两套完整3D人体解剖模型,包含运动系统(全身骨骼,肌肉,骨连结)、内脏系统(消化,呼吸,泌尿,生殖)、脉管系统(心血管,淋巴)、神经系统、内分泌系统及感觉器,助力系统化学习解剖。 ●局部解剖:从表入里逐层剖析,分为头颈部、胸部、腹部、盆部与会阴、脊柱区、上肢部、下肢部七大区域,详细掌握人体各部的位置形态、毗邻关系以及层次结构。 ●运动解剖:独家的引体向上、俯卧撑、投篮等专项动作3D运动轨迹分析,动态展示肌肉动作,清晰呈现原动肌、协同肌和稳定肌的联动关系,快速掌握运动系统的工作原理。 ●针灸经络:符合新国标标准的3D经络穴位,创新性地将经络穴位与人体解剖完美结合,完整呈现十二经脉与奇经八脉在人体内外的循行路径,穴位周围解剖结构清晰可见,独家的穴位剖面图谱,还有真人取穴与进针操作视频、3D进针动画演示等资源。 ●影像断层:基于真实临床影像数据,收录全身各部位X线平片与断层扫描影像。配备专业解剖标注,实现从二维影像判读到三维空间理解的全面提升。 ●测练题库:提供5000+3D题库与文字题库,可免费使用全部题库资源,自主选择练习、测试等多种学习模式;支持教师按教学进度自由组题布置,共享解剖练习题。 ●解剖大挑战:强化记忆解剖知识的“利器”!全面涵盖骨骼、肌肉、脉管等人体各大系统,把全身解剖结构打通,根据挑战情况自动生成个性化标识反馈,有效加强记忆。 ●成绩管理:快速创建线上班级或团队,统一管理学生或学员作业,随时查看每位成员作业完成状况;自动生成成绩分析报告,实时呈现学情数据,老师可精准掌握班级整体知识薄弱点,快速定位教学重点,大幅减轻批改负担。 ●AR趣味学习:将模型融入现实环境,可对模型进行自定义编辑,支持层级、极简、拆分、切割等工具操作,打破屏幕局限,实现虚实结合的解剖学习体验。 ●支持PPT导入3D模型:将3D模型嵌入到PPT进行实时交互,打造数字化解剖PPT,让演示更生动直观。 ●多终端适用:支持电脑、手机、pad。
